Arriving at FC Barcelona midway through last season to rescue the struggling club under Xavi Hernandez, Vitor Roque never managed to make his mark. Despite receiving a warm welcome, the 19-year-old forward couldn’t integrate as expected. After just a few matches, he completely faded from the spotlight. Signed for a hefty sum by Deco and Joan Laporta, the star who had shone at Atletico Paranaense in Brazil (2022–2023, 81 matches and 28 goals) was even pushed out at the start of the current season.
Frustrated by the treatment he received at Barça, Vitor Roque decided to revive his career far from Catalonia. Currently on loan at Real Betis, where he has already scored 5 goals in 14 matches, the player still under contract with the Catalan side has made a comment that may likely prevent him from ever donning the Barça jersey again. In an interview with Real Betis’ official channel, Roque made an unexpected nod to Madrid legend Cristiano Ronaldo.
CR7 ahead of Messi and Neymar for Roque

After discussing his whirlwind arrival in La Liga last December, the teenager spoke about his childhood idol, who, contrary to expectations, is not Lionel Messi, as most Catalan players often claim. “My idol? Cristiano. And I also really like Neymar, for his style of play and Brazilian magic. But Cristiano too, to be honest,” Vitor revealed in remarks relayed by Goal.
